The Matsuoka Museum of Art opened in April, 2000. The founder of the museum was a successful businessman, Seijiro Matsuoka (1894-1989). His collection: Chinese ceramics, Oriental ceramics, Egyptian, Greek, Roman, and Indian Gandhara art, Japanese paintings, modern European paintings and modern sculptures.
